Typed Exactly As Was Printed In The Newspapers:
N. H. AVERY
N. H. Avery, colored, one of Broken Bow, eldest darkies, passed away at his home here Wednesday. Avery resided here approximately 30 years, and was employed as janitor in the former Broken Bow First National Bank for twenty years.
Services were held Thursday.
Broken Bow News
Thursday, February 4, 1943
**************************
N. H. AVERY
BROKEN BOW, Feb. 9. --- N. H. Avery, aged Negro, died at his home here recently. Spigner funeral home, Idabel, was in charge of burial in Broken Bow cemetery.
Avery was employed several years as a janitor at the McCurtain County bank here.
McCurtain Gazette
Wednesday, February 10, 1943
